/freebsd-9.3-release/lib/libc/rpc/ |
H A D | authdes_prot.c | 81 xdr_authdes_verf(xdrs, verf) 83 struct authdes_verf *verf; 88 ATTEMPT(xdr_opaque(xdrs, (caddr_t)&verf->adv_xtimestamp, 90 ATTEMPT(xdr_opaque(xdrs, (caddr_t)&verf->adv_int_u, 91 sizeof(verf->adv_int_u)));
|
H A D | svc_auth_des.c | 120 struct authdes_verf verf; local 172 verf.adv_xtimestamp.key.high = (u_long)*ixdr++; 173 verf.adv_xtimestamp.key.low = (u_long)*ixdr++; 174 verf.adv_int_u = (u_long)*ixdr++; 209 cryptbuf[0] = verf.adv_xtimestamp; 212 cryptbuf[1].key.low = verf.adv_winverf; 285 verf.adv_nickname = (u_long)sid; 303 verf.adv_xtimestamp = cryptbuf[0]; 309 *ixdr++ = (long)verf.adv_xtimestamp.key.high; 310 *ixdr++ = (long)verf [all...] |
H A D | auth_unix.c | 242 authunix_validate(auth, verf) 244 struct opaque_auth *verf; 250 assert(verf != NULL); 252 if (verf->oa_flavor == AUTH_SHORT) { 254 xdrmem_create(&xdrs, verf->oa_base, verf->oa_length,
|
H A D | auth_des.c | 277 struct authdes_verf *verf = &ad->ad_verf; local 355 ATTEMPT(xdr_authdes_verf(xdrs, verf)); 368 struct authdes_verf verf; local 380 verf.adv_int_u = (uint32_t)*ixdr++; 398 verf.adv_timestamp.tv_sec = IXDR_GET_INT32(ixdr) + 1; 399 verf.adv_timestamp.tv_usec = IXDR_GET_INT32(ixdr); 404 if (bcmp((char *)&ad->ad_timestamp, (char *)&verf.adv_timestamp, 413 ad->ad_nickname = verf.adv_nickname;
|
/freebsd-9.3-release/lib/librpcsec_gss/ |
H A D | rpcsec_gss.c | 268 rpc_gss_validate(AUTH *auth, struct opaque_auth *verf) argument 289 gd->gd_verf.value = mem_alloc(verf->oa_length); 295 memcpy(gd->gd_verf.value, verf->oa_base, verf->oa_length); 296 gd->gd_verf.length = verf->oa_length; 304 checksum.value = verf->oa_base; 305 checksum.length = verf->oa_length; 570 struct opaque_auth creds, verf; local 586 * for the verf. 641 verf [all...] |
/freebsd-9.3-release/sys/rpc/ |
H A D | auth_unix.c | 264 authunix_validate(AUTH *auth, uint32_t xid, struct opaque_auth *verf, argument 270 if (!verf) 273 if (verf->oa_flavor == AUTH_SHORT) { 275 xdrmem_create(&txdrs, verf->oa_base, verf->oa_length,
|
/freebsd-9.3-release/sys/rpc/rpcsec_gss/ |
H A D | rpcsec_gss.c | 491 struct opaque_auth creds, verf; local 560 verf.oa_flavor = RPCSEC_GSS; 561 verf.oa_base = checksum.value; 562 verf.oa_length = checksum.length; 564 xdr_stat = xdr_opaque_auth(xdrs, &verf); 588 rpc_gss_validate(AUTH *auth, uint32_t xid, struct opaque_auth *verf, argument 604 * The client will call us with a NULL verf when it gives up 607 if (!verf) { 621 gd->gd_verf.value = mem_alloc(verf->oa_length); 629 memcpy(gd->gd_verf.value, verf [all...] |
/freebsd-9.3-release/include/rpcsvc/ |
H A D | nfs_prot.x | 690 writeverf3 verf; 718 createverf3 verf; 1119 writeverf3 verf;
|
/freebsd-9.3-release/sys/nfsserver/ |
H A D | nfs_serv.c | 2751 u_quad_t off, toff, verf; local 2763 verf = fxdr_hyper(tl); 2768 verf = 0; /* shut up gcc */ 2802 if (!error && toff && verf && verf != at.va_filerev) 3050 u_quad_t off, toff, verf; local 3068 verf = fxdr_hyper(tl); 3103 if (!error && toff && verf && verf != at.va_filerev)
|
/freebsd-9.3-release/sys/fs/nfsserver/ |
H A D | nfs_nfsdport.c | 1551 u_int64_t off, toff, verf; local 1568 verf = fxdr_hyper(tl); 1587 if (!nd->nd_repstat && toff && verf != at.na_filerev) 1802 u_int64_t off, toff, verf; local 1820 verf = fxdr_hyper(tl); 1856 if (off && verf != at.na_filerev) { 1870 } else if ((nd->nd_flag & ND_NFSV4) && off == 0 && verf != 0) {
|
H A D | nfs_nfsdserv.c | 3283 u_char *verf, *ucp, *ucp2, addrbuf[24]; local 3291 verf = (u_char *)tl; 3308 NFSBCOPY(verf, clp->lc_verf, NFSX_VERF);
|
/freebsd-9.3-release/sys/fs/nfsclient/ |
H A D | nfs_clvnops.c | 2546 u_char verf[NFSX_VERF]; local 2554 error = nfsrpc_commit(vp, offset, cnt, cred, td, verf, &nfsva, 2558 if (NFSBCMP((caddr_t)nmp->nm_verf, verf, NFSX_VERF)) { 2559 NFSBCOPY(verf, (caddr_t)nmp->nm_verf, NFSX_VERF);
|